Porcelain soup plate, decorated in gold with a frieze of vine on the marli and a cluster of grapes in the basin, in the center a rosette, gold net on the edges. Good condition. Royal Manufacture of Sevres, Louis XVIII period, 1816-1824. Mark with the blue stamp with the figure of the king Louis XVIII, gilder's mark. D. 24 cm. Provenance This service called "frise d'or vigne" entered the Sèvres sales store on 19 February 1819 (Arch. Sèvres, Vv1, 118 v°). Twelve dinner plates were sold to the miniaturist painter Moriot in September 1843 (Vz6, 141 v°) but the majority of the service was offered as a prize to the Mont-de-Marsan races by the Mayor in June 1852, including 72 dinner plates, 15 soup plates, including this one, and two navette butter dishes (Vbb11, 272)
